Bean star to reprise spoof 007 role

Mr Bean is turning into Mr Bond as Rowan Atkinson dons a tuxedo to play a super-spy.

But with his usual comic gift Atkinson turns his new character Johnny English into a bumbling secret agent.

The accident prone character first saw life in a hit series of Barclaycard ads in which he haplessly roamed the world accompanied by sidekick Bough.

Now he has been reinvented as a gun-toting hero – albeit rather hapless – who is sent by the intelligence service MI7 to rescue the Crown Jewels from villainous Frenchman Pascal Sauvage, played by John Malkovich.

Bough is back, this time played by comic actor Ben Miller – from TV’s Armstrong And Miller and the movie The Parole Officer.

Love interest is provided by Aussie soap-turned-pop star Natalie Imbruglia in her first major movie role.

It is not the first time that the Bond series have been parodied, with Mike Myers making a fortune through his Austin Powers films.

And it is not the first time that Atkinson himself has had a brush with Bond. He appeared in the Sean Connery comeback vehicle Never Say Never Again in 1983 as a man from the ministry sent to track down 007.

Since then Atkinson – who turned 48 yesterday – has found international fame in the movie Bean, featuring his celebrated buffoon Mr Bean.

Johnny English has been scripted by Neal Purvis and Robert Wade who were behind the most recent Bond film, Die Another Day, and directed by Peter Howitt, who made low budget hit Sliding Doors.

It hits cinemas on April 11.
